He built a house
A beautiful home
He filled it with people
So he was never alone
But he built his home on mud
They were happy for years
Were the envy of their peers
And they survived
Through blood, sweat
And tears
But sadly, he built his home on mud
When the floods arrived
All were deprived
His home washed away
No one survived
Oh God!
His life! His Family!
His blood!
Why did he build it on mud?
